WebApr 12, 2024 · This should highlight the eight anchor points surrounding the image. Move your cursor to the corner anchor point you want to use to scale the image. Hold down the Command+Shift keys (or Control+Shift keys if you're working on a Windows-based computer) then hold down the mouse button and drag to scale proportionately. WebMay 23, 2012 · To scale multiple selected objects proportionately, press the Cmd+Shift (Mac) or Ctrl+Shift (PC) keys, then drag one of the selection handles outward to scale up or inward to scale down. Scale the strokes or not? You might notice that strokes you’ve applied to objects are also scaled when you user this keyboard shortcut.
